> The current OpenOfficeParser first reads the entire meta.xml and content.xml files from the given OpenDocument zip into memory, then parses the in-memory files to DOM trees, merges the trees, and finally evaluates a number of XPath expressions against the resulting DOM tree to extract metadata and document content. All this requires quite a bit of memory and multiple passes over the document.
> It would be better if the document could be streamed directly through zip and sax parsers without keeping a full copy of the document in memory or doing multiple passes over the document.
